Output 367c9b109a85bc55a907c841614d7083fe2a2a8e6658a4ebd2bbaf7ec639a87a:2

value
9124900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54b86a9e9af0f77aa017abb3a445e0fafa2a6e10 OP_EQUAL
address
MFd7v2T1sLBLKq4dvrrs5Qq6gMAUmaPHHy
transaction
367c9b109a85bc55a907c841614d7083fe2a2a8e6658a4ebd2bbaf7ec639a87a
spent
true